What's a lower-maintenance alternative to my high-input lawn?
Transitioning sun-drenched areas to a palette of North Shore natives like Coastal Panic Grass, Beach Plum, and Butterfly Milkweed significantly reduces water, fertilizer, and mowing demands. These deep-rooted plants stabilize soil against erosion. This shift also future-proofs your landscape against evolving noise ordinances restricting gas-powered blowers and mowers.
Are bluestone patios a good long-term choice here compared to wood decks?
Permeable bluestone pavers offer superior longevity in Halesite's coastal climate, resisting moisture decay and salt air corrosion that degrade wood. Their non-combustible nature also contributes to defensible space, which is beneficial even with the area's low Fire Wise rating. Properly installed on a gravel base, they provide a stable, low-maintenance surface for decades.
My yard stays soggy for days after rain. Is this a shoreline saturation issue?
Likely yes. Your acidic sandy loam, combined with Halesite's high coastal water table, leads to persistent saturation. Improving subsurface drainage is the primary solution. Where hardscape is needed, specifying permeable bluestone pavers increases ground absorption and can help projects meet the Town of Huntington's stormwater runoff management standards.
Can I keep my Kentucky Bluegrass lawn healthy under Stage 1 water conservation?
Yes, with precise management. Smart Wi-Fi ET-based irrigation controllers adjust watering schedules daily using local evapotranspiration data. This system delivers water only when the turfgrass blend actually needs it, preventing overwatering. This technology is key to maintaining turf health while adhering to voluntary conservation and preparing for potential stricter municipal limits.

What invasive species should I watch for, and when can I treat them?
Japanese knotweed and mugwort are prevalent threats in this area. Manual removal or targeted, professional-grade herbicide application is most effective. All treatments must comply with the Suffolk County Fertilizer Law, which prohibits nitrogen and phosphorus applications from November 1 to April 1, so plan chemical interventions for late spring or early fall.
Why does my lawn seem so compacted and thin compared to newer neighborhoods?
Halesite homes, averaging 74 years of age, have mature soils with decades of layered organic matter and foot traffic. The native acidic sandy loam naturally compacts over time, reducing percolation and root zone oxygen. Core aeration in early fall, followed by top-dressing with compost, is critical to counteract this legacy compaction and rebuild soil structure without drastically altering the pH.
What permits and credentials are needed for regrading my backyard?
Significant regrading on a 0.35-acre lot typically requires a permit from the Town of Huntington Planning Department to ensure proper drainage and erosion control. The contractor must hold appropriate licensing through the NYS Department of State. This protects you, as licensed professionals are required to carry insurance and adhere to codes governing soil disturbance near the shoreline.
